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

A sheet processing apparatus includes a first and second alignment members that moves relatively in a width direction to align a position of a sheet in the width direction. Each alignment member includes a contact surface configured to come in contact with an end of the sheet in the width direction, a lower portion configured to support a lower surface of the sheet, and an upper portion facing an upper surface of the sheet. For each of the first and second alignment members, the lower portion is more distant from the contact surface than the upper portion in the width direction, the lower portion is positioned above a lower end of the contact surface in a gravity direction, and a distance between the upper portion and the lower portion in the gravity direction is smaller than a length of the contact surface in the gravity direction.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

1 .- 16 . (canceled) 17 . A sheet processing apparatus comprising: a conveyance member configured to convey a sheet; a pair of alignment members configured to move relatively in a width direction orthogonal to a conveyance direction of the sheet by the conveyance member, so as to align a position of the sheet in the width direction; a lower portion configured to support a lower surface of the sheet between the pair of alignment members in the width direction; and a pair of upper portions arranged on one side and the other side of the lower portion in the width direction and each configured to hold an upper surface of the sheet, wherein the pair of upper portions is positioned lower than the lower portion in a plane vertical to the conveyance direction. 18 . The sheet processing apparatus according to claim 17 , further comprising: a supporting portion configured to support the lower surface of the sheet aligned by the pair of alignment members; an upper guide facing the supporting portion in a gravity direction and configured to guide the upper surface of the sheet supported by the supporting portion; an upper projecting portion projecting upward from the supporting portion when viewed in the conveyance direction; and a lower projecting portion arranged on one side and the other side of the upper projecting portion in the width direction and projecting downward from the upper guide when viewed in the conveyance direction, wherein the lower portion is an upper end portion of the upper projecting portion, and the pair of upper portions is a lower end portion of the lower projecting portion. 19 . A sheet processing apparatus comprising: a conveyance member configured to convey a sheet; and a pair of alignment members configured to move relatively in a width direction orthogonal to a conveyance direction of the sheet by the conveyance member, so as to align a position of the sheet in the width direction, the pair of alignment members each comprising a contact surface configured to come in contact with an end portion of the sheet in the width direction, wherein at least one of the pair of alignment members comprises a lower portion configured to support a lower surface of the sheet that is in contact with the contact surface, and an upper portion positioned between the lower portion and the contact surface in the width direction and configured to hold an upper surface of the sheet that is in contact with the contact surface, and wherein in a plane orthogonal to the conveyance direction, the lower portion is positioned above a lower end of the contact surface in a gravity direction, and a distance between the upper portion and the lower portion in the gravity direction is smaller than a length of the contact surface in the gravity direction. 20 .
